Output 58e61612ef2123c622ca99597d3f5b4b0a37db75ebe8383ae8ca2715bac194a7:1

value
1451190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88dedafcdffc06c70b1ef03097b942f6693080b8 OP_EQUAL
address
3EAinu5q64v6rGoVLb2ULsjZEwj4xBfLDj
transaction
58e61612ef2123c622ca99597d3f5b4b0a37db75ebe8383ae8ca2715bac194a7
spent
true